The Evolution of the Australian Online Casino Scene

Over the past decade, online casinos in Australia have moved from niche entertainment portals to highly regulated, innovative platforms that cater to a broad demographic. The market’s explosive growth is exemplified by recent data indicating that Australian online gambling revenue surpassed AUD 1.5 billion in 2022, reflecting a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of approximately 8% since 2015 (Source: Australian Gambling Statistics).

This growth is fueled by technological innovations such as mobile gaming, live dealer platforms, and blockchain integrations, which are transforming user experiences and operational models. However, these advancements are paralleled by rigorous regulatory responses aimed at consumer protection and illicit activity mitigation.

Regulatory Landscape and Industry Oversight

The Australian Communications and Media Authority (ACMA) and the Northern Territory’s licensing regime are central to regulatory oversight. Recent reforms emphasize robust licensing standards, responsible gambling measures, and evidence-based compliance protocols. The introduction of the Interactive Gambling Act (IGA) 2001 has further solidified legal boundaries, targeting illegal offshore operators and ensuring licensed entities uphold high standards.

Key Regulatory Frameworks in Australian Online Gambling
Regulation/Act Scope & Impact Recent Developments
Interactive Gambling Act (IGA) 2001 Regulates online wagering and prohibits unlicensed operators Amended in 2017 to strengthen enforcement against illegal operators
Northern Territory Licensing Regime Provides licensing for online operators targeting Australian players Enhanced responsible gambling and anti-money laundering requirements in 2022

Emerging Technologies and Consumer Trust

Innovation in digital gaming platforms enhances transparency and fairness, which are pivotal to establishing consumer trust. Blockchain-based solutions, for instance, enable provably fair algorithms, ensuring players can independently verify game outcomes. Furthermore, real-time data analytics assist operators in monitoring for problem gambling behaviors.

Case Study: Credibility and Responsible Gaming at Leading Operators

Leading online operators in Australia are now routinely integrating features like deposit limits, self-exclusion tools, and real-time responsible gaming alerts. Transparency initiatives often include detailed disclosures on payout percentages (known as Return to Player, or RTP), which industry data suggests average RTPs for slot machines range from 92% to 96%, depending on the provider and game type (Source: EGBA Annual Report).
